Nikos Nikolaou, a prominent Greek painter, captured the essence of Hydra, a Greek island, in his 1950 artwork "Houses at Hydra." The painting depicts a cluster of traditional whitewashed houses with distinctive blue accents, characteristic of the island's architecture. Nikolaou's use of simple shapes and flat colors creates a sense of serenity and timeless beauty, highlighting the architectural details and capturing the vibrant hues of the Mediterranean landscape. The artwork reflects a distinct style of painting common in Greece during the mid-20th century, focusing on everyday scenes with a focus on local color and architectural elements. "Houses at Hydra" is a quintessential example of Nikolaou's ability to convey the spirit of Greece and its landscapes, and it remains a cherished depiction of the island's charm.
